首页
合作流程
常见问题
服务价格
新闻中心
公司简介
专业IOS签名团队
闪电售后,性价比秒杀上架,快速上线、测试
提供 iOS 企业证书签名服务,让您的 iOS App 无需提交 App Store 或设置
UDID 即可在iPhone、iPad 等设备上直接安装,帮助您快速完成应用内测
过程,降低测试成本,缩短上线时间。
在线咨询
企业签名是什么意思(企业签名有哪些作用和原理)
企业签名
是什么意思(企业签名有哪些作用和原理)。企业签名在移动应用开发领域属于常见服务类型。它的重要意义在于,能够让开发者为自己的应用程序附上信任标志,以此保障应用程序的完整性,并且让应用的来源具备可靠性。
通常而言,企业签名服务是由专业的签名服务供应商来提供的。这些供应商会针对企业或者开发者颁发一个数字证书,这个证书涵盖了应用程序的公钥、颁发机构的标识以及证书的有效期等关键信息。
企业签名的作用是多方面的。其一,信任标识方面。企业签名给予应用程序信任标识,这使得用户能够相信该应用是由受信任的机构或者企业推出的。这种信任标识在提升应用程序的下载量以及获取用户信任方面有着积极的作用。其二,审核流程方面。借助企业签名,开发者可以避开App Store的审核流程,直接将应用分发给用户。这对于那些需要快速更新版本并且进行测试的应用程序而言,是极为有用的手段。其三,分发管理方面。企业签名支持开发者把应用程序分发给特定的用户群,像是企业内部的员工、负责测试的人员或者合作伙伴等。这种分发模式能够确保应用程序在特定的范围内传播,有效防止未经授权的用户获取。
企业签名的原理主要依赖公钥加密技术。在数字签名环节,开发者运用自己的私钥对应用程序签名,而用户则使用开发者提供的公钥来验证签名是否有效。详细的数字签名生成和验证流程如下:首先,数字证书的生成。签名服务提供商要先为企业或者开发者生成数字证书,其中包含应用程序的公钥、颁发机构标识以及证书有效期等信息。其次,应用程序签名。开发者使用私钥对应用程序进行签名,这个签名过程实际上是对应用程序的哈希值进行加密,从而生成一个数字签名,这个数字签名会和应用程序一同分发给用户。最后,数字签名验证。用户收到应用程序和数字签名后,用开发者提供的公钥对数字签名解密,得到应用程序的哈希值,然后用户自己计算应用程序的哈希值,并与解密得到的哈希值对比。若二者相同,则表明应用程序在传输过程中未被篡改,并且确实是持有该私钥的开发者所签名。
企业签名尽管存在很多优势,但在使用时也有不少需要关注的要点。由于它能绕过App Store审核,开发者必须保证应用程序的安全性,防止恶意软件或者病毒的出现。并且,因为企业签名的分发范围比较宽泛,开发者要合理管控应用程序的分发范围,防止未经授权的用户获取。此外,开发者要挑选值得信赖的签名服务提供商,从而确保数字证书的安全性和有效性。
综上所述,企业签名是一项为移动应用程序赋予信任标识并提供分发便利的服务。它凭借公钥加密技术达成数字签名和验证流程,确保应用程序的完整性与来源可靠性。在运用企业签名时,开发者需要重视应用程序的安全性、分发范围以及对可信赖签名服务提供商的选择等问题。
以上就是小编分享的内容,希望能为您带来帮助。更多详情请关注
app签名
:
http://www.ahaiba.cn
点击咨询客服
友情链接:
深圳公司注销
苹果企业签名
app签名
©2012-2019 FSNS 版权所有
苹果企业签名
苹果签名
ios企业签名